/// Specifies the name for value of option or positional arguments. This name is cosmetic only,
/// used for help and usage strings. The name is **not** used to access arguments.
///
/// # Example
///
/// ```no_run
/// # use clap::{App, Arg};
/// # let matches = App::new("myprog")
/// # .arg(
/// Arg::with_name("debug")
/// .index(1)
/// .value_name("file")
/// # ).get_matches();
pub fn value_name(mut self, name: &'n str)
-> Self {
if let Some(ref mut vec) = self.val_names {
vec.push(name);
} else {
self.val_names = Some(vec![name]);
}
self
}
